Pros

Great 401k match Product discounts Co-workers are in it together

Cons

With addition of new CMO, all career growth opportunity has stopped. Significant number of new outside senior hires without current employees being given an opportunity to fill these positions. CMOs belief is digital is the direction of the future and thus current employees can’t be successful in new roles completely discounting the already existing team of digital employees who have a strong background and can lead Marketing team into the future if given a chance. She has driven out majority of long term employees with strong skill sets and passed over loyal employees who have remained. What was once a great place to work has now turned to shambles and the clock just ticks forward everyday as we watch previously valued team members forced out the door weekly.

Pros

The people in non- upper management roles that work there are fantastic. Great sense of community onsite and the culture champions are consistently looking for ways to make work life better.

Cons

Very poor communication on the strategy for the business unit. Leadership publicly promotes innovation and new ideas to be presented but then those ideas are shot down or penalized in private by current upper management. The business unit leadership says that don't want excuses for project delays but will then decide to do 3 major layoffs in the first two quarters with no transition plan, no support for gap in resources and no expectations to delayed progress.
